The Toughest Part of Strategy? Execution!

Six Disciplines

Strategy formulation, while extremely challenging and difficult, is usually not what concerns most small business leaders. It''s the execution of strategy that keeps many small business leaders awake at night! Execution represents a disciplined process that enables an organization to take a strategy and make it work.

The Five Reasons Strategies Fail

Six Disciplines

In a survey of 163 CEOs by Forbes Insights in conjunction with the Association for Strategic Planning and the Council of Public Relations Firms, chief executives report that one-third of corporate strategies fail, and they fail for five reasons. The five reasons why strategies fail are: Unforeseen external circumstances (24 percent).
